What was the purpose of the 10th Amendment?

Back

To limit the authority of the federal government

Answer explanation

The 10th Amendment was designed to limit the authority of the federal government by reserving powers not delegated to it for the states and the people, ensuring a balance of power.

Which of the following is an example of a Civic Duty? Reporting for Jury Duty, Volunteering for the food bank, Being a good person, Driving a car

Back

Reporting for Jury Duty

Answer explanation

Reporting for Jury Duty is a civic duty because it is a legal obligation for citizens to participate in the judicial process, ensuring a fair trial. The other options, while positive, do not constitute legal responsibilities.
